Gaming Performance

Average Frame Rate:

With an average of 365 FPS as opposed to 276.7 FPS on the Intel CPU, the Ryzen 7 9800X3D beats the i9-14900K by about 27.5%.

1% Lows:

The i9-14900K records 201.2 FPS, demonstrating a 23.4% improvement in frame constancy, while the Ryzen 7 9800X3D smoothes down gameplay with 1% lows at 254.8 FPS.

Productivity & Multithreaded Performance

  • i9-14900K’s Cinebench R23 Multi-Core score is 38,497, 65% higher than Ryzen 7 9800X3D’s 23,313.
  • AMD Ryzen 7 9800X3D scores 18,366 Geekbench 6 Multi-Core with 22,637 i9-14900K.
  • The i9-14900K renders the scene in 671 seconds, over twice as fast than the Ryzen 7 9800X3D (344 seconds).

Multithreaded Workloads (3D Rendering & Video Editing)

Intel Core i9-14900K:

  • Its increased core/thread count (24 cores, 32 threads) makes it superior for demanding multithreaded operations like rendering in Blender, V-Ray, Adobe Premiere Pro, After Effects, and DaVinci Resolve.
  • provides improved performance when juggling other demanding programs and quicker encoding/export times.

AMD Ryzen 7 9800X3D:

  • The massive 3D V-Cache allows for excellent gaming and some creative tasks (particularly in cache-sensitive apps like Unreal Engine or certain plug-ins).
  • With only 8 cores and 16 threads, it is not as fast for rendering as the i9-14900K.

Thermals & Power Consumption

  • The Ryzen 7 9800X3D is probably cooler and uses less electricity.
  • The i9-14900K may quickly reach high power drain when rendering and needs strong cooling, particularly when under constant load.

Advantages & Disadvantages

Intel Core i9-14900K

Advantages

  • Outstanding multi-threaded performance, perfect for professional applications and content production.
  • Increased boost clock rates, up to 6.0 GHz.
  • Allows for system construction flexibility by supporting both DDR4 and DDR5 memory styles.
  • Intel UHD 770 integrated graphics, which in some situations can replace a separate GPU.

Disadvantages

  • With a maximum turbo TDP of 253W, this power consumption is higher, requiring reliable cooling solutions.
  • Due to the LGA 1700 socket’s near-end lifetime, there are less options for future upgrades.

Ryzen 7 9800X3D AMD

Advantages

  • Outstanding performance in gaming, outperforming the i9-14900K by up to 27.5% in average frames per second.
  • A 96 MB L3 cache improves performance in games and some applications.
  • With a 120W TDP, more power-efficient.
  • Better thermal efficiency is provided by the contemporary 4nm process it is built on.

Disadvantages

  • Does not have integrated graphics and needs a separate GPU.
  • In jobs that need a lot of threading, a lower core and thread count may affect performance.

Specifications

FeatureIntel Core i9-14900KAMD Ryzen 7 9800X3D
ArchitectureHybrid (8 Performance + 16 Efficiency cores)Zen 4 with 3D V-Cache
Cores / Threads24 cores / 32 threads8 cores / 16 threads
Base Clock3.2 GHz (P-cores)4.7 GHz
Boost ClockUp to 6.0 GHz (P-cores)Up to 5.4 GHz
L3 Cache36 MB96 MB
Manufacturing ProcessIntel 7 (10nm)TSMC 4nm
TDP125W (Base) / 253W (Max Turbo)120W
SocketLGA 1700AM5
Memory SupportDDR4 / DDR5DDR5
PCIe SupportPCIe 5.0PCIe 5.0
Integrated GraphicsIntel UHD Graphics 770None
Price (as of March 2025)~$432~$479

Conclusion

In many games, the AMD Ryzen 7 9800X3D has the highest frame rate and smoothest gameplay.

The Intel Core i9-14900K is perfect for multi-threaded software development, 3D rendering, and video editing for professionals and content makers.

Your choice should match your major use case. The Ryzen 7 9800X3D offers unmatched gaming performance, while the i9-14900K offers strong productivity features.
